Where Is Turkish Airlines at LGW?
First things first—if you're heading to London Gatwick Airport, Turkish Airlines operates from North Terminal. This is your main hub for check-in, boarding, and customer service if you're flying Turkish. The Turkish Airlines is well-organized, easy to navigate, and packed with everything a traveler might need—food, lounges, duty-free shopping, and speedy check-in counters. Check-In and Baggage Services
The check-in process at the Turkish Airlines is smooth and traveler-friendly. If you're flying business class, there’s a dedicated line to speed things up, which I highly recommend using if available. For economy travelers, lines move fairly quickly as long as you arrive with enough buffer time—ideally 3 hours before your international flight. If you're carrying extra baggage, Turkish Airlines staff are quite helpful in guiding you through the payment and tagging process. Lounge Access – A True Delight
One of the best things about flying from the Turkish Airlines is access to the No1 Lounge at North Terminal, which Turkish Airlines passengers can enjoy depending on ticket class or loyalty status. And let me tell you—it’s worth it. With comfy seating, complimentary snacks, drinks (including prosecco—yes, please!), Wi-Fi, and even showers, this lounge is a perfect escape from the usual airport chaos.
